  • Nickel AlloyAlloy 825 — Alloy 825 is a material that is ductile and easily fabricated. Primarily consisting of nickel and chromium, as well as a combination of iron, copper and molybdenum, this alloy has excellent resistance to stress corrosion. Because of these corrosion resistance characteristics, it is often used in chemical processing, marine exhaust systems and radioactive waste handling.
  • Alloy 925 — A nickel-based alloy containing chromium and iron, as well as smaller increments of molybdenum, aluminum, copper, and titanium, this material is strong and corrosion resistant. It is suitable for valves, packers, tubulars, pumps shafts, and more applications in sour gas and marine environments.
  • Monel 400 — Composed of nickel and copper, as well as carbon, iron, silicon, and manganese, this material is similar to Alloy 925 in its strength and corrosion resistance. Monel 400 is suitable for use in acidic and alkaline environments such as heat exchangers, valves, pumps, chemical processing, and marine engineering.
  • Alloy 800 — Comprised of chromium, iron, and nickel, alloy 800 is part of the “INCOLOY®” alloy series, created by the Special Metals Corporation. This material provides strength, stability, and resistance to both corrosion and heat, making it suitable for heat exchangers, heat-treating equipment, piping systems, and domestic appliances.
